Taxation on foreign companies in India refers to the tax obligations imposed on companies incorporated outside India but earning income within the country. Such income, including royalties, fees, or business profits, is taxed under the Income Tax Act, 1961, based on the source rule and applicable tax treaties https://nricaservices.com/